Automotive logistics refers to the efficient management and transportation of vehicles, spare parts, components, and finished vehicles from manufacturers to dealers, and ultimately to customers. This market plays a crucial role in streamlining the supply chain and ensuring cost-effective and timely delivery of automotive products.

B) Market Key Trends:
One key trend in the North America Automotive Logistics Market is the increasing adoption of electric vehicles (EVs), driven by growing environmental consciousness and government regulations aimed at reducing carbon emissions. With major automakers investing heavily in EV production, logistics providers have also adapted to cater to the unique requirements of EVs. For instance, specialized transportation and handling processes for the safe transportation of EV batteries and infrastructure development for charging stations are becoming more prominent in the market.

C) Porter’s Analysis:
– Threat of New Entrants: The North America Automotive Logistics Market poses moderate barriers to entry due to the high initial investment required for establishing a logistics network, including warehousing facilities, transport vehicles, and IT systems. Additionally, established players benefit from economies of scale and long-term partnerships with automotive manufacturers, making it difficult for new entrants to compete effectively.
– Bargaining Power of Buyers: The strong bargaining power of buyers in the North America Automotive Logistics Market is driven by the presence of a large number of automotive manufacturers. Buyers have the ability to demand competitive prices, efficient logistics services, and customized solutions to meet their specific requirements.
– Bargaining Power of Suppliers: Logistics service providers rely on a network of suppliers for vehicles, spare parts, and transportation equipment. The bargaining power of suppliers is moderate due to the availability of multiple suppliers and the ability of logistics providers to switch suppliers based on cost, quality, and reliability.
– Threat of New Substitutes: The threat of new substitutes in the North America Automotive Logistics Market is relatively low. The complexity and unique requirements of automotive logistics, including security, specialized handling, and just-in-time delivery, make it challenging for alternative modes of transportation to replace traditional logistics services.
– Competitive Rivalry: The North America Automotive Logistics Market exhibits high competitive rivalry, with leading logistics providers competing based on factors such as service quality, cost efficiency, reliability, technology integration, and geographic reach. Continuous innovation and strategic partnerships with automotive manufacturers further intensify competition within the market.

– Key Players: Key players operating in the North America Automotive Logistics Market include Ceva Logistics Ag, Kuehne + Nagel International Ag, DHL International GmbH (Deutsche Post Ag), Ryder System, Inc., United Parcel Service, Inc., DB Schenker (Deutsche Bahn Ag), XPO Logistics, Inc., DSV A/S, Nippon Express Co., Ltd., and Geodis. These players possess a strong market presence, extensive network capabilities, and offer a wide range of automotive logistics services to cater to the growing demand.
